Abstract:
The objective of this project is to develop an Android Shopping Assistant and
Recommender. Application that can scan barcodes effectively and produce its prices on
the customer’s android phone screen so a person can shop within a certain budget. This
report explains the methods people make use of for their shopping purposes and their
preferences and how it can be incorporated in a single application making use of
technology. It gives a brief introduction and the review of technology and different
applications. Finally, it explains the methodology of the project and the end product of
the studies and implementation that is achieved through this project.
This project undertaken is developed using the Android technologies. The main
advantage of using Android Operating System is that it provides various features and
functionalities that are suitable for developing the Shopping Assistant and
Recommendation application. The Shopping Assistant and Recommendations works
with first capturing an image of the products barcode and searches for a match from the
database through a simple image detection algorithm in the form of an API working at
its backend. This application is designed to facilitate the user for his/her shopping trips
and maintain the item’s list that has to be purchased with continuously comparing and
tallying items prices. The items are maintained according to user’s purchasing history.
Recommendations for future development and conclusions are also included in the report.